Oven-Roasted Banana Foster with Vanilla Ice Cream

By AislePrompt Test Kitchen · Reviewed by AislePrompt Editorial · ·

Sweet bananas roasted with brown sugar, butter, and rum-spiced sauce, served warm over creamy vanilla ice cream for a classic indulgent treat. Instructions

  1. Step 1: Preheat oven to 400°F. In a small saucepan over medium heat, melt 4 tbsp unsalted butter with 1/3 cup packed light brown sugar, stirring until sugar dissolves and mixture is bubbly — about 3 minutes.
  2. Step 2: Remove from heat and stir in 2 tbsp dark rum, 1/2 tsp ground cinnamon, and 1 tsp vanilla extract.
  3. Step 3: Arrange 4 peeled bananas halved lengthwise in a single layer in a 9x13-inch baking dish.
  4. Step 4: Pour the butter-rum sauce evenly over the bananas, coating them thoroughly.
  5. Step 5: Roast bananas in the preheated oven for 12-15 minutes until caramelized and tender, basting once halfway through with the pan juices.
  6. Step 6: Serve the warm roasted bananas immediately topped with 1 scoop of vanilla ice cream per serving, spooning additional sauce over the top.
